With Total Investment of 1.8 Billion Yuan, Jingjiang Dike Comprehensive Harnessing Project Completed

After more thanfour years of construction, the main body of Jingjiang Dike comprehensiveharnessing project has been completed, and the flood control capabilities inflood season will be greatly enhanced.

On April 2, whendriving along the Jingjiang dike for tens of kilometers, the reporter foundthat the pavement on the dike was smooth and tide, all the ponds in theembankment had been filled and the trees all along had sprouted to display abeautiful scene of vitality. 

As the first-classembankment in China, the Jingjiang Dike is 182.35 kilometers long to provideprotection over 18,000 square kilometers of areas, including 11 million mu of cultivated lands and a populationof more than 10 million, therefore it’s also known as the “life dike” of theJianghan Plain.

According to theintroduction of Jingzhou Yangtze River Administration Bureau, the Jingjiangdike had been reinforced twice before 2007. However, due to the early designand low standard, some hidden safety hazards still existed such as poor earthfilling and dike foundation as well as many ponds all along the embankment. 

At the end of 2014,the comprehensive harnessing project of Jingjiang dike started with a totalinvestment of 1.8 billion yuan. Up to now, the main body has been basicallycompleted, about 86km of new anti-seepage wall has been built, 121km ofembankment has been grouted and more than 200 ponds had been filled, a fewprojects have entered the stage of finishing nowadays. 

Embankmentbeautification is also an important part of the harnessing project. “TheJingjiang dike with ‘one embankment and one road covered with forest on bothbanks’ has become a beautiful landscape.” Zha Yuqing, who has worked on theYangtze River dike for more than 30 years, said that before the harnessingproject, the embankment top was full of pits and rambling houses withinsufficient vegetation. After the harnessing project, the whole dike has beenchanged into a landscape belt as the backyard garden of the residents livingalongside. 

The deepestanti-seepage wall is as tall as 20 floors

"Jingjiangsection is the most dangerous part of the Yangtze River.” Due to the bendingriver section and complicated relationship between rivers and lakes, the floodsfrequently occurred along the Jingjiang section in history.

What changes havebeen brought to the Jingjiang dike in the third large-scale reinforcement? “Theconstruction of anti-seepage wall is an important part of this reinforcementproject.” According to Zou Zhanhong, the director of Engineering TechnologyOffice of Jingzhou Yangtze River Administration, on some embankments of theJingjiang dike, the earth filling is complicated with poor anti-seepagecapability. In flood season, the dike will be endangered by the risks of seepage,piping and scattered immersion, therefore it is urgent to implement anti-seepagetreatment. 

In thisreinforcement project, the anti-seepage wall of 86 kilometers and 1.44 millionsquare meters has been newly constructed. The maximum depth of anti-seepagewall in Jianli Yaoqinao section is 85 meters as high as over 20 floors with athickness of 1500px, which sets the record of the similar projects in China."The application of anti-seepagewall technology in the reinforcement project has greatly reduced the risks ofpiping and scattered immersion along the Jingjiang dike." Zou Zhanhongintroduced. Taking Jingzhou Muchenyuan section and Jianli Yaoqinao section asthe examples. Before the harnessing engineering, the accidents of piping andpiping group had occurred in 2007 and 2012 respectively and the dike itself wasalso suffered from the danger of scattered immersion.After the completion of the anti-seepagewall in June 2015, the hazards of flooding and piping had been effectivelyreduced in flood seasons from 2016 to 2018. 

The filling ofponds is also the focus of this harnessing.Before 2014, there were more than 300ponds of different sizes along the Jingjiang dike, including 19 big ponds. Somewere as deep as 8 meters and only 50 meters away from the foot of the dike.Once the water level rose, the ponds andthe flood would impose a threat on the dike from the front and the rear. Afterthe comprehensive harnessing, the ponds of over 1.5m deep within 200 metersalong the Jingjiang dike have been filled to remove the threat. “Since thecomprehensive harnessing, the flood control capacity, information level andaesthetics of the Jingjiang dike have been greatly improved.” Zou Zhanhong toldthe reporter of Hubei Daily that the flood control capability of Jingjiang dikehad been raised to resist the floods of once in 20 years; when in coordinationwith the Three Gorges Reservoir, the flood control capability had been raisedto resist the floods of once in 100 years; the comprehensive use of the ThreeGorges Reservoir, the flood storage area in Jingjiang area and the sub floodstorage area in Honghu can ensure the safety of the Jingjiang section in floodseason and avoid the devastating disaster due to dike break. 

Threereinforcements on Jingjiang dike 

The Jingjiang dikewas built from the first year of the Yonghe Emperor to the second year of the XingningEmperor in the Eastern Jin Dynasty. According to the introduction of theJingzhou Yangtze River Administration Bureau, the Jingjiang dike started to becompletely renovated by three large-scale reinforcements since theestablishment of the new China. 

The first phase ofreinforcement: From 1974 to 1983, the government invested 118 million yuan onthe infrastructure of bank reinforcement for risks removal.

The second phase ofreinforcement: From 1983 to 2007 with the investment of 852 million yuan on thereinforcement of the embankment, the revetment and the construction of dikemanagement facilities.

The phase of comprehensiveharnessing: From 2014 to 2018 with the investment of 1.8 billion yuan on theconstruction of anti-seepage wall, pond filling and embankment greening, etc.
